Geospatial Technician

Description

Text copied to clipboard!
We are looking for a dedicated and detail-oriented Geospatial Technician to join our dynamic team. The ideal candidate will have a strong background in geographic information systems (GIS), remote sensing, and spatial data analysis. As a Geospatial Technician, you will play a crucial role in collecting, analyzing, and interpreting geographic data to support various projects and initiatives within our organization. You will collaborate closely with engineers, planners, environmental scientists, and other professionals to ensure accurate and efficient management of spatial information. Your primary responsibilities will include creating and maintaining GIS databases, producing detailed maps and visualizations, and conducting spatial analyses to support decision-making processes. You will also be responsible for ensuring data accuracy, integrity, and consistency across all geospatial datasets. Additionally, you will assist in the development and implementation of GIS-related workflows, procedures, and standards to enhance the efficiency and effectiveness of our geospatial operations. The successful candidate will possess excellent analytical and problem-solving skills, with the ability to interpret complex geographic data and translate it into actionable insights. You should be proficient in using GIS software such as ArcGIS, QGIS, and other related tools. Familiarity with remote sensing technologies, GPS equipment, and spatial data collection methods is also essential. In this role, you will have the opportunity to work on diverse projects ranging from urban planning and environmental conservation to infrastructure development and disaster management. You will be expected to stay current with emerging trends and technologies in the geospatial industry, continuously improving your skills and knowledge to contribute effectively to our team's success. Strong communication and interpersonal skills are essential, as you will be required to present your findings and recommendations clearly and effectively to both technical and non-technical audiences. You should also be comfortable working independently as well as collaboratively within a multidisciplinary team environment. Responsibilities

  • Collect, analyze, and interpret geographic data using GIS software and tools.
  • Create and maintain accurate GIS databases and spatial datasets.
  • Produce detailed maps, visualizations, and reports to support project objectives.
  • Conduct spatial analyses and modeling to inform decision-making processes.
  • Ensure data accuracy, integrity, and consistency across all geospatial datasets.
  • Assist in developing and implementing GIS workflows, procedures, and standards.
  • Collaborate with multidisciplinary teams to support various geospatial projects.
  • Stay current with emerging trends and technologies in the geospatial industry.

Requirements

  • Bachelor's degree in Geography, GIS, Environmental Science, or related field.
  • Proficiency in GIS software such as ArcGIS, QGIS, or similar tools.
  • Experience with remote sensing technologies and spatial data collection methods.
  • Strong analytical, problem-solving, and critical-thinking skills.
  • Excellent communication and interpersonal abilities.
  • Ability to work independently and collaboratively within a team environment.
  • Attention to detail and commitment to data accuracy and integrity.
  • Familiarity with GPS equipment and field data collection techniques.
